My feelings is phylogenically speaking Dionaea has just recently crawled out of the water onto the land, since its affinities to Aldrovanda are now proven by genitic analysis. Also it is true that the genus may not have been always monotypic.

Variation tested through natural selection over millions of years of evolution can yield some very surprising (and successful) events that often may lead to a "variety" replacing a "species" outcompeting its progenitors. 10 million years later with no fossil record, who is to say which came first, the chicken or the egg?

Such is the case with D. anglica which has far outcompeted D. linearis which is one of the parents. It could be that there were various intermediate forms of Dionaea, outcompeted and extinct now, or a common but extinct ancestor that also gave rise to Aldrovanda. Species is a verb, not a noun and what we see is the thinnest slice of reality, like the 3 blind men each trying to figure out what animal they are touching when each touches a different part of the elephant.
